In the average bladder, the muscular tissue stays relaxed while the bladder progressively fills out. With urgency incontinence, the muscle contracts prematurely and triggers need to pee, often enabling bladder leakage. Labor and distribution might stretch, stress or perhaps tear the muscular tissues and the sustaining cells that hold the womb, bladder and anus in their proper location. The nerves might also be stretched and harmed, weakening the signals allowing muscular tissues to work properly. As time goes on and the typical adjustments of aging and weakening of the tissues occurs, urinary incontinence may result. At present, just advanced and costly tests like MRI or nerve conduction research studies can tell if these muscular tissues and nerves have actually gone back to normal. Regrettably, there is no practical, easy method at this moment for you or your doctor to understand if these muscles are weakened and destined to lead to urinary incontinence. You can blame this usual postpartum symptom on the maternity- and delivery-weakened muscle mass around the bladder and pelvis, which might have a more challenging time managing your flow after childbirth. You might experience this loss of bladder control while chuckling, sneezing, coughing or executing a arduous activity, and it's really typical after delivering. As a matter of fact, it's estimated that concerning half of adult women might experience postpartum urinary incontinence.
